This bill includes over $9 billion in appropriations for 22 nondefense programs that are not authorized by law. Nine of these programs receive a total of $185 million more than their enacted 2016 level. Several of these programs have not been authorized since the 1980s, and one has never been authorized by Congress. My amendment is simple. My amendment would reduce unauthorized nondefense accounts to the 2016 levels. My amendment would also cut around $185 million and send that money to the spending reduction account. In a time when we, as a Nation, are approaching close to $20 trillion in debt, we cannot continue to fund unauthorized accounts in our appropriations process. This is a democratic Nation, and the men and women send the Members of this body, not to slip unauthorized programs in appropriations bills, but to have an open discussion on our funding priorities. Furthermore, the inclusion of appropriations for these programs in the reported bill is a violation of clause(2)(a)(1) of rule XXI of the rules of the House. I applaud Representative Tom McClintock and Conference Chair Cathy McMorris Rodgers for their significant work to raise awareness of the problem of unauthorized appropriations and work towards a solution so that the House actually enforces its rules.…
